    Your Archives:About - Your Archives

    It is in the form of a Wiki. You can submit your own information, e.g. will transcriptions.

    I stumbled across it again (I must have seen it some time ago) when a Google search brought up the wording of a will (I'm transcribing a Chancery case and I'm checking the terminology used).

    I could upload several transcriptions. I must have a better look to see what they offer.
